On Wed, Mar 01, 2017 at 04:42:17PM -0800, Joel Fernandes wrote: > Hi, > > On 3.18 kernel running on an arm64 device, I tried running: > perf record -a -g -e sched:sched_wakeup > > I was expecting something like the output at: > www.brendangregg.com/perf.html > > But I don't see stacktraces, could I be missing any patches you could > point me to?
I can't spot much obvious, looking at arm64's stacktrace.c and perf_callchain.c since v3.18. There's commit:
9702970c7bd3e2d6 (Revert "ARM64: unwind: Fix PC calculation")
... though that was Cc'd stable.
I can't immediately see why that would truncate unwinding, though I'm also not sure how perf and ftrace interact here, so I may be missing something obvious.
